Jan 18, 2024 · The radian is the angle formed by two radii, lines from the center to the outside circumference of a circle, where the arc formed is equal to the radius. An angle in radians can be calculated by dividing the length of the arc the angle cuts out by the radius of the circle (s/r). There are 360° in every circle, equal to 2π radians. Radians are used to measure angles. You might be more used to measuring angles with degrees, in which case it should help to think of radians as a different sized unit to measure the same thing. A 360 degree angle is the same as a 2pi radian angle. Radians start being used in geometry and trig as you start using the unit circle. So we call this pi radians. Pi radians is 180 degrees. As you point out, the radian measurement of an angle is the ratio of the length of an arc the angle intercepts to the length of the radius of said arc. As both arc length and radius are measured with units of length, these units of length cancel when determining how many radians an angle is. This is why radians are dimensionless - there is ...One radian is: the measure of a central angle that intercept an arc where length of arc = length of radius of circle. To Find Radians. Divide length of the arc S by the radius r. Relationship Between Radians and Degrees. One rad is equal approximately to the absorbed dose delivered when soft tissue is exposed to one roentgen of medium …The rad is a unit of absorbed radiation dose, defined as 1 rad = 0.01 Gy = 0.01 J/kg. It was originally defined in CGS units in 1953 as the dose causing 100 ergs of energy to be absorbed by one gram of matter. The material absorbing the radiation can be human tissue, air, water, or any other substance. Learn how to calculate radians from degrees, how to use radians for small angles and sine and tangent functions, and why radians are …The radian per second (symbol: rad⋅s−1 or rad/s) is the unit of angular velocity in the International System of Units (SI). The radian per second is also the SI unit of angular frequency (symbol ω, omega). The radian per second is defined as the angular frequency that results in the angular displacement increasing by one radian every second.Sep 16, 2022 · Formally, a radian is defined as the central angle in a circle of radius \(r \) which intercepts an arc of length \(r \), as in Figure 4.1.2. To convert an angle from degrees to radians we multiply the angle by radian e.g: Q. Convert 150° angle into radian. Jan 18, 2024 · Arc length is a measurement of distance, so it cannot be in radians. The central angle, however, does not have to be in radians. It can be in any unit for angles you like, from degrees to arcsecs. Using radians, however, is much easier for calculations regarding arc length, as finding it is as easy as multiplying the angle by the radius. Formula for $$ S = r \theta $$ The picture below illustrates the relationship between the radius, and the central angle in radians. ...If the length of an arc that this angle cuts off the circle equals to its radius, then, by definition, this angle's measure is 1 radian. If an angle is twice as big, the arc it cuts off the circle will be twice as long and the measure of this angle will be 2 radians.
